Historical Overview

Rush county was organized in 1821 and was named in honor of Dr. Benjamin Rush, a signer of the Declaration of Independence. Its population in 2020 was 16,752. Rushville is the county seat.

Rush County Information

Townships

Anderson, Center, Jackson, Noble, Orange, Posey, Richland, Ripley, Rushville, Union, Walker, Washington

Towns

Carthage, Glenwood, Rushville, Arlington, Manilla, Milroy

Surrounding Counties

Henry, Fayette, Franklin, Decatur, Shelby, Hancock

Rush County Genealogist

County genealogists are invaluable resources for anyone seeking to delve into the past. They can answer general questions about the county, providing insights into its history, culture, and communities. Need to know where specific records are held or where to find them? County genealogists are experts at pointing you in the right direction. They’ll also inform you about what records exist and, just as importantly, which records do not exist, saving you valuable research time.

County genealogists can recommend search avenues and tools tailored to your specific needs, ensuring you’re on the right track to uncovering your family’s history. Please note that while they are fantastic information resources, they are not typically able to conduct genealogy research for you. Instead, they empower you with the knowledge and tools you need to embark on your own genealogical journey.
